Menü Klappbar...
#11
http://mylittlehomepage.net/ajax-tutorial-datenabfrage


sowas??? siehe beispiele ?

im übrigen wäre das meine lösung Wink

wie du sie gern hättest.

macht ja das java alles. setzt die andern tests auf hidden und das angeklickte auf vissible
du musst aber noch bei der <div id="test1"></div> ... ein style mit hidden festlegen. da die sonst beim ersten aufruf alle angezeigt werden.
  Zitieren
#12
Ok, also nun bin ich ganz verwirrt...

Wie müsste das beispiel dann aussehen in meinen menü kinggo ? Schau dir einfach mal den quelltext an ;-)
Liebe Grüße,
cHAp  :drink:

Meine Webseite: xprog.de - mailda.de - wazesn.de - chatworkers.de
  Zitieren
#13
Puhh Gute Frage Big Grin

:bier:

also erstma soll das für boardseven.de sein oder was denke ist fürn Kd. schick mirn Source ich baus ein Wink
  Zitieren
#14
ne ne is schon für mein portal... ;-)

den code kannst dir ausn quelltext nehmen ;-)
Liebe Grüße,
cHAp  :drink:

Meine Webseite: xprog.de - mailda.de - wazesn.de - chatworkers.de
  Zitieren
#15
mach ich dan heute zuhause, hab n8schicht da hab ich da eigt. keine zeit.
  Zitieren
#16
Code:
..........
<script type=text/javascript>
function punkt1() {
if(document.getElementByID('test1').style.visibility=='hidden') {
  document.getElementByID('test1').style.visibility='visible';
  document.getElementByID('test2').style.visibility='hidden';
  document.getElementByID('test3').style.visibility='hidden';
}
}
function punkt2() {
if(document.getElementByID('test2').style.visibility=='hidden') {
  document.getElementByID('test1').style.visibility='hidden';
  document.getElementByID('test2').style.visibility='visible';
  document.getElementByID('test3').style.visibility='hidden';
}
}
function punkt3() {
if(document.getElementByID('test3').style.visibility=='hidden') {
  document.getElementByID('test1').style.visibility='hidden';
  document.getElementByID('test2').style.visibility='hidden';
  document.getElementByID('test3').style.visibility='visible';
}
}
</script>
.........
        <td onclick=punkt1() class="tdhead">&nbsp;<b>Sport</b></td>
        </tr>
        <tr>
        <td width="2"><img src="images/spacer.gif" border="0" height="1" width="2"></td>
        </tr>
<!-- DIV -->
<div id="test1" style="visibility: hidden;">
        <tr>
        <td class="topnavi"><a href="index.php?show=portal/sport/index" class="linkwxb">» Sport Allgemein</a></td>
        </tr>
        <tr>
        <td width="2"><img src="images/spacer.gif" border="0" height="1" width="2"></td>
        </tr>
        <tr>
        <td class="topnavi"><a href="index.php?show=portal/sport/formel1" class="linkwxb">» Formel 1</a></td>

        </tr>
        <tr>
        <td width="2"><img src="images/spacer.gif" border="0" height="1" width="2"></td>
        </tr>
        <tr>
        <td class="topnavi"><a href="index.php?show=portal/sport/fussball" class="linkwxb">» Fußball-Bundesliga</a></td>
        </tr>
        <tr>

        <td width="2"><img src="images/spacer.gif" border="0" height="1" width="2"></td>
        </tr>
        <tr>
        <td class="topnavi"><a href="index.php?show=portal/sport/skispringen" class="linkwxb">» Skispringen</a></td>
        </tr>
</div>
<!-- DIV -->

so und dan immer so weiter z.b.
  Zitieren
#17
Zitat:Original von KingGO
mach ich dan heute zuhause, hab n8schicht da hab ich da eigt. keine zeit.

Ne sollst du ja auch nicht und danke für das Script ... :knuddel: :daumen:

Werde es heute nacht, sofern mein Kreislauf wieder flott ist einbaun... Hab eben die ganze zeit geschlafen... ;( Confusedchlaf:
Liebe Grüße,
cHAp  :drink:

Meine Webseite: xprog.de - mailda.de - wazesn.de - chatworkers.de
  Zitieren
#18
Portal BoardSeven und Aktuelle Nachrichten eingebaut aber funktioniert nicht.


http://www.boardseven.net/header-too.php
Liebe Grüße,
cHAp  :drink:

Meine Webseite: xprog.de - mailda.de - wazesn.de - chatworkers.de
  Zitieren
#19
Code:
<script language="javascript">
currentShownDiv = "";

function klapp(id)
{
currentShownObj = document.getElementById(currentShownDiv);

if (currentShownObj != null)
currentShownObj.style.display='none';

if (id == currentShownDiv)
{
currentShownDiv = "";
return;
}

currentShownDiv = id;

objToShow = document.getElementById(id);

if (objToShow.style.display == 'none')
{
objToShow.style.display='block';
}
else
{
objToShow.style.display='none';
}
}
</script>
</head>

<body>

<a href="javascript:void(0);" onclick="klapp('1');" onfocus="blur();">MENÜ 1</a><br /><br />

<div id="1" style="display:none;">
- UNTERPUNKT<br />
- UNTERPUNKT<br />
- UNTERPUNKT<br />
- UNTERPUNKT<br />
</div>
<a href="javascript:void(0);" onclick="klapp('2');" onfocus="blur();">MENÜ 2</a><br /><br />
<div id="2" style="display:none;">
- UNTERPUNKT<br />
- UNTERPUNKT<br />
- UNTERPUNKT<br />
- UNTERPUNKT<br />
</div>
<a href="javascript:void(0);" onclick="klapp('3');" onfocus="blur();">MENÜ 3</a><br /><br />
<div id="3" style="display:none;">
- UNTERPUNKT<br />
- UNTERPUNKT<br />
- UNTERPUNKT<br />
- UNTERPUNKT<br />
</div>
</body>

Der geht hab ich auf Arbeit gemacht. bitte. Confusedchlaf:
  Zitieren
#20
Das ist perfekt. Funktioniert. Gibts ne möglichkeit noch das wenn man beispielsweise Community offen hat und wenn man dann dort im menü geklickt hat die Katekorie auch offen bleibt. Geht das irgendwie ?
Liebe Grüße,
cHAp  :drink:

Meine Webseite: xprog.de - mailda.de - wazesn.de - chatworkers.de
  Zitieren


Gehe zu:


Benutzer, die gerade dieses Thema anschauen: 6 Gast/Gäste